A Toast to Tradition: The History and Cultural Significance of Liqueurs

From ancient rituals to modern-day celebrations, liqueurs have held a special place in human culture for centuries. Their origins can be traced back to medieval Europe, where monks refined techniques for infusing spirits with spices. Liqueurs quickly gained popularity as both a delicious indulgence and a healing remedy.

Across history, liqueurs have evolved alongside cultural trends, taking on unique flavors and styles in different regions of the world. In France, for example, cognac-based liqueurs like Crème de Cassis are renowned for their elegance and sophistication. Meanwhile, Italy's rich tradition of liqueur production has given rise to bold flavors like limoncello and amaro.
